This is a visual I created last year to work on fluency goals with kindergarten-aged children who stutter. I found it to be useful when describing "smooth speech" (vs. repetitions or blocks) to children who stutter and for increasing their awareness of fluency in conversation.
This is just a simple chart I made to be used with the game "Angry Birds: On Thin Ice" which I purchased at Chapters. It gives ideas for following directions, including simple 2 step-directions, directions with location concepts, directions with temporal concepts, and directions with conditional concepts.
